"Safe" with regards to medication does not mean "100% without side effects or issues". Placebo has harmful effects. I've seen toxicity from water. It's about individualizing medication use, dosing, and monitoring.

Comments that H5N1 isn't real makes my head hurt. There are 18 different H's & 11 N's. When 2 different strains infect a host at the same time, they can get mixed up and put together an H and N that have never paired before. Its called "bird" because H5N1 1st emerged in a bird.

πŸ” New Study: In adults with septic shock, receipt of at least 30 mL/kg of fluid within 2–3 hours from recognition is linked to reduced odds of mortality and need for mechanical ventilation.
